Is It True That Aluminum Foil Can Improve Wi-Fi?

Surprisingly, yes but it’s not as simple as just wrapping your router like a baked potato.

Aluminum foil can affect your Wi-Fi signals because Wi-Fi uses radio waves to transmit data between your router and your devices. And guess what? Radio waves can be reflected by metal surfaces, just like a mirror reflects light.

When you place aluminum foil strategically around your router, you can bounce these signals toward the areas of your home where you need them most. Instead of the signals scattering in all directions (including places you don’t need them, like a closet or outside the house), the foil helps focus the signals.

In short:
  • Aluminum foil doesn’t create a stronger signal.
  • It redirects the existing signals to better cover areas where you want better internet.
This means you might see a real difference in weak spots — without spending a single extra dollar!

Improvement in Signals or Stronger Signals?

Let’s clear this up:

Aluminum foil will not increase your router’s power.
Your internet speed is determined by your internet service provider (ISP) and your router’s design.

What foil can do is:

  • Improve the signal in a specific area.
  • Strengthen weak spots where the Wi-Fi had trouble reaching before.
  • Make your connection more stable by guiding the signal better.
On the flip side, by concentrating the signal toward certain areas, you might lose a bit of coverage in other directions. For example, if you boost the living room, the kitchen might get slightly weaker signals.

Think of it like adjusting a flashlight:

You can focus the beam on one spot to make it brighter, but then other areas won’t be lit up as much.

How Does Aluminum Foil Boost Internet?

Let’s get a little more technical but keep it simple.

Wi-Fi routers send signals in all directions unless they are "beamed" (some modern routers do have directional antennas, but most home routers are omnidirectional). The problem is, not all directions are useful.

  • Some signals bounce around walls and furniture.

  • Some signals go outside your house.

  • Some just fade away into corners where you don't even need internet.

When you use aluminum foil, you are adding a reflective surface that redirects the Wi-Fi waves. The metal changes the path of the radio waves, steering them toward your desired spot — like your bedroom, gaming area, or home office.

Why aluminum?

Because aluminum is a good conductor and a great reflector for electromagnetic waves like Wi-Fi. It’s cheap, flexible, and easy to shape around your router without causing damage.

How Helpful Is This Hack?

This hack can be very helpful, but only under certain conditions.

Aluminum foil is great if you:

  • Have Wi-Fi dead zones or weak areas in your house.

  • Want to boost signal strength in a specific room.

  • Are looking for a free or cheap way to improve your Wi-Fi without buying new equipment.

However, it won’t help if you:

  • Have an old or outdated router that can’t handle high speeds.

  • Have a bad internet plan from your ISP.

  • Live in a house with extremely thick walls (like concrete or brick) where signals are heavily blocked.

In those cases, upgrading your router, adding a Wi-Fi extender, or switching to a mesh network might be better solutions.

How You Can Use This Hack

Trying the aluminum foil trick is simple and only takes a few minutes. Here’s how you can do it:

Materials You Need:

  • Aluminum foil (regular kitchen foil is fine)

  • Scissors (optional, to shape the foil)

Steps:

  1. Create a Curved Panel:
    Tear off a piece of foil and bend it into a curved shape. It should look like a little "dish" or a shallow curve.

  2. Position the Foil:
    Place the curved foil behind your router’s antennas. If your router doesn’t have antennas, place it behind the body of the router, facing the area you want the signal to go.

  3. Aim the Open Side:
    The open (curved) side should face the area where you want better Wi-Fi.

  4. Test and Adjust:
    Walk around with your smartphone or laptop and check the signal strength. You might need to tweak the angle of the foil to get the best results.

Important Tip:
Don't wrap the entire router in foil! Routers generate heat and need ventilation. Wrapping them completely can cause them to overheat and break.

Everything You Need to Know About the Kawasaki Corleo


Kawasaki is showing off a hydrogen-powered, four-legged robot at the Osaka Expo 2025, giving us a look at the future of off-road personal transportation. The robot looks like a robotic horse or maybe a lion, based on the name "Corleo." While the concept was created by Kawasaki Heavy Industries (the parent company of Kawasaki Motors), you can still see a lot of motorcycle technology in it.

In the official video, the Corleo charges across all sorts of rugged terrain, showing off what’s called “the handling and stability of Kawasaki’s legendary motorcycles.” The robot’s "head" even has a hint of a sportbike’s front fairing, giving it a sleek, futuristic look. The rest of it? Well, it kind of reminds you of a Cylon from Battlestar Galactica, with its bold, high-tech design. And those three striking green stripes on its front? They practically scream Monster Energy vibes, making the Corleo look like a high-powered, adrenaline-fueled beast ready to take on anything!

Kawasaki says the Corleo is controlled by the rider shifting their weight on the stirrups and handlebar, and the video shows riders adopting a jockey-like crouch at high speeds and more upright postures for low speeds or climbing uneven terrain.

The Corleo’s four legs are fitted with rubber hooves, designed to absorb bumps and keep it stable on any surface. What’s really cool, especially from a motorcycle lover’s point of view, is that the back half of the Corleo acts like a swingarm, pivoting from where the stirrups connect to the main body just like a bike’s rear suspension!

The Corleo’s legs are powered by electricity created by a 150cc hydrogen engine tucked between the front legs. The fuel tanks are cleverly stored in the back, giving this robotic beast all the power it needs to move.

An instrument panel displays the hydrogen level along with navigation, center of gravity position, and other information. In dark conditions, navigation markers are also projected onto the surface ahead.

It goes without saying that the video above is almost entirely CGI. The Corleo on display at the Osaka Expo can stand and adjust its posture, but otherwise has very limited mobility. There’s still a long way before it can achieve the kind of agility as shown in the demo video. The concept is primarily a thought exercise, with no plans for production.
